The Much Honoured Baron of Braemar Co-Authors Puerto Rico’s National Policy on AI in Education

The Much Honoured Ambassador Otto Federico von Feigenblatt of Braemar, Baron of Braemar, has served as a principal co-author of the Department of Education of Puerto Rico’s foundational policy, “Guide for the use of Artificial Intelligence for student learning.” Promulgated in December 2025, this definitive instrument establishes the framework for the integration of Artificial Intelligence within the classroom, providing essential guidance for pedagogues, rectors, and the student body alike. His Lordship, a scholar of high standing in educational leadership and Special Envoy for Education to the Andean Parliament, presided over a delegation of learned scholars from the House of Feigenblatt to assist the Department in this noble endeavour.
